NAPA — In response to the Napa Valley Wine Train debacle, Oakland Food is hosting a "Wine Soul Train" on September 26 that stops at black- and Latino-owned vineyards. Customers are encouraged to "laugh loudly;" get your tickets here. [EaterWire]

HAYES VALLEYBirba is now serving Sunday brunch with dishes like nectarine pancakes and poached eggs on toast with heirloom tomatoes, prosciutto and chive butter. [Hoodline]

THE CASTROStarbelly's cooking up a "BBQ Ribs Summer Patio Picnic" with brown sugar-rubbed pork ribs, cornmeal grits, collard greens and more Southern classics. Head here for tickets to the Tuesday, September 15 event. [EaterWire]
